/* Helpers for daemonization.
|
||||
* bb_daemonize(flags) = daemonize, does not compile on NOMMU
|
||||
* bb_daemonize_or_rexec(flags, argv) = daemonizes on MMU (and ignores argv),
|
||||
* rexec's itself on NOMMU with argv passed as command line.
|
||||
* Thus bb_daemonize_or_rexec may cause your <applet>_main() to be re-executed
|
||||
* from the start. (It will detect it and not reexec again second time).
|
||||
* You have to audit carefully that you don't do something twice as a result
|
||||
* (opening files/sockets, parsing config files etc...)!
|
||||
*
|
||||
* Both of the above will redirect fd 0,1,2 to /dev/null and drop ctty
|
||||
* (will do setsid()).
|
||||
*
|
||||
* Helper for network daemons in foreground mode:
|
||||
* bb_sanitize_stdio() = make sure that fd 0,1,2 are opened by opening them
|
||||
* to /dev/null if they are not.
|
||||
*/
